What Is Experiential Therapy?

Experiential therapy encourages creative expression, action and emotionally immersive experiences to help individuals process and heal from past trauma, emotional struggles and disordered eating behaviors. This therapeutic approach focuses on active engagement in therapeutic activities that allow clients to access and express emotions that may be difficult to articulate through words alone.

Experiential Therapy can include activities such as:

  • Art therapy
  • Music therapy
  • Movement/dance therapy
  • Restorative yoga
  • Drama therapy

These activities create a safe, non-judgmental space for individuals to explore their emotions, identify patterns in their thinking and behaviors and connect mind and body. By engaging in these creative processes, clients can access deeper emotional states that might be difficult to reach through traditional forms of therapy alone.

How Experiential Therapy Supports Eating Disorder Recovery

Eating disorders are often linked to deep emotional pain, unexpressed feelings and body disconnection. Experiential therapy provides a powerful way to break through emotional barriers and address these underlying issues in a tangible, embodied way.

Experiential therapy helps individuals:

  • Reconnect with their emotions and express feelings that may have been suppressed or avoided due to the shame or trauma associated with eating disorders
  • Release pent-up emotions and reduce stress through movement, creativity and physical expression
  • Build a healthy connection with their body through activities like yoga and movement therapy, improving body awareness and self-compassion
  • Process trauma or past experiences that may have contributed to the development or maintenance of an eating disorder
  • Develop new coping skills and healthier ways of expressing emotions without resorting to disordered eating behaviors

By addressing emotions and experiences that are difficult to express verbally, experiential therapy creates a more holistic approach to healing and empowers individuals to approach their recovery in new and meaningful ways.

Experiential Therapy in Our PHP & IOP Programs

Recognizing that creative expression and emotional release are vital components of the eating disorder recovery process, Seeds of Hope incorporates experiential therapy into our PHP and IOP programs. In our structured therapeutic environment, clients participate in:

  • Art Therapy – Using various forms of art to explore emotions, increase self-awareness and break free from rigid thought patterns associated with eating disorders
  • Music Therapy – Expressing emotions and experiences through music, helping to release emotional blockages and increase feelings of emotional connection and self-worth
  • Restorative Yoga – Engaging in gentle yoga to promote physical and emotional healing as well as foster a connection to the body in a non-judgmental, compassionate way
  • Movement Therapy – Using movement and dance as a means to explore and express emotions, improving emotional regulation and self-awareness
  • Drama Therapy – Engaging in role-playing or storytelling to process emotions and trauma in a safe, creative environment

These therapies are integrated with other evidence-based treatments, like CBT, DBT and ACT, to create a well-rounded, comprehensive treatment plan.
